Dual voltage
The appliance can work on both, 120V or 230V, AC
systems. Be sure the dual voltage selector is in
the correct voltage position before plugging in.
To do this, switch the selector which is above the
handle to the right position.
This is a 120V dual voltage appliance and may be
used in North America without an electrical
converter. An adapter plug may be necessary
when using appliance in foreign countries.
If needed, plug the steambrush into the correct adapter plug for the
specific country and plug assembly into electrical outlet.
Warning! Never switch selector while unit is plugged in.

Filling with water

• Your steam brush has been designed to operate using untreated tap
water. If your water is very hard (check with your local water authority) it
is possible to mix tap water with distilled water in the following
proportions:
- 50% untreated tap water
- 50% distilled or demineralised water.
• Remove any packaging from the appliance.
• Do not plug in or turn on until assembly is
complete.
• Set the voltage to the correct position.
• Remove the lint pad by pulling it to the bottom.
(depending on model)
